The Story Behind The Dish

The Chocolate Fondant is a test of precision. Sixty seconds too long in the oven, and it is just a chocolate cake. Sixty seconds too short, and it collapses. In that perfect window, it becomes something transcendent.

Origin: France

Chef's Notes

“Timing is everything. The oven must be exactly 200 degrees. The ramekins must be buttered and dusted with cocoa powder. When the fondant comes out, the exterior should be firm, the interior liquid gold. The first spoonful should make you pause.”

— Pastry Chef Priya Rao
